Description
The Halmstad is an 850mm wooden bollard light combining a treated pine column with black powder-coated steel top and base sections. An E27 bulb (sold separately, up to 60W) sits inside a horizontal-louvre steel cage at the top, behind an opal polycarbonate diffuser that spreads light outward and downward. The IP65 rating protects internal components from dust and water jets, making the fitting suitable for exposed coastal locations, driveways and garden pathways.
Designed for driveways, pathway edges, garden borders and patio perimeters, the Halmstad provides low-level wayfinding light without the glare of taller post lights. The 850mm height sits below eye level for most adults, keeping the light source itself out of direct view when walking past. The 120mm-square footprint fits into narrow planting beds or along gravel path edges where wider bollards would obstruct movement. The fitting mounts onto a ground spike or concrete base depending on ground type and soil stability.
The treated pine column is coated to resist moisture ingress and UV degradation but will still weather over time depending on sun exposure and rainfall levels. In sheltered locations the wood retains its medium-brown tone for 2-3 years before silvering; in full coastal exposure or south-facing positions the silvering happens sooner. The black powder-coated steel top and base sections resist corrosion but may show patina in high-salt coastal air after 12-18 months of exposure. The horizontal steel louvres around the lamp housing direct light horizontally while shielding the bulb from direct overhead view.
The opal diffuser softens the light output, turning a single bare bulb into a softer wash across a 2-3m radius depending on bulb wattage and colour temperature chosen. Most users pair the Halmstad with a warm-white 6-10W LED E27 at 2700K-3000K for pathway lighting or a cooler 4000K daylight LED for security-focused illumination.

Frequently Asked
What bulb does it take?
The Halmstad takes a standard E27 (Edison screw) bulb up to 60W maximum. Bulbs are sold separately. Most users pair this with a 6-10W warm-white LED at 2700K-3000K for pathway lighting or a 4000K daylight LED for security applications.
How is it mounted?
The bollard can be mounted onto a ground spike (for soft soil or lawns) or bolted onto a concrete base (for driveways or paved areas). Mounting hardware is not included — choose the method based on your ground type and intended location.
Will the wood change colour over time?
Yes. The treated pine is coated to resist moisture and UV damage but will still weather naturally. In sheltered locations the medium-brown tone lasts 2-3 years before silvering. In full sun or coastal exposure the silvering happens sooner. This is normal weathering, not a defect.
Is the IP65 rating suitable for coastal locations?
Yes. IP65 protects the internal components from dust and water jets, making the fitting suitable for coastal exposure. The powder-coated steel may develop patina in high-salt air after 12-18 months, which is typical weathering for outdoor metal fittings in marine environments.
